[IMAGE] OpenSPA 8.5 for VU+
What is new
– New drivers:
Gigablue Quad 4k Pro.
update createswap to fix quad4kpro slot 7
Zgemma H17.
update v3d driver add first working version
Gigablue Trio Pro.
update change bt enabler.
VU+ Solo 4k, VU+ Uno 4K, VU+ Uno 4K SE, VU+ Zero 4K.
add ScrambledPlayback Support.
– Update release from 8.4 to 8.5 with these changes :
OE-A 5.5.1 ( styhead )
openssl 3.3.1
Python 3.12.9
gstreamer 1.24.12
glibc 2.40
ffmpeg 7.0.2
gcc 14.2.0
– Kodi 21.2
– New DVB hardware accelerator for Kodi’s video player (beta)
– Kodi’s configuration screen in Plugins (the default player is now set to this screen, not in the OpenSPA settings)
– Modified the poster image for series in e2player and added an image for the title.
– Update tailscale to 1.82.0
– Update rclone to 1.69.1

EPG:
– Search for EPG: Fixed overlapping text in the Search for EPG list, reported by samlukin.
CAMD Manager:
– Fixed problems initializing Cam Control, which occurred when there were ASCII-encoded shell scripts in the same path as the Cam Scripts, reported by pitu.
Network:
– Fixed enabling and/or disabling Ethernet with DHCP.
– Displays “Your network configuration has been disabled” if the network has been disabled.
– If the wizard is not active, Ethernet (no internet), you can return to try again (previously, the basic wizard would inevitably start).
– Display Ethernet or Wi-Fi IP in the wizard.
– Wi-Fi enabled in the wizard:
You can now use the virtual keyboard in the wizard to assign the Wi-Fi password (press the TEXT key on your controller).
Added an informative message for the next step when activated.
Display:
– Enigma Display settings for GigaBlue Hisilicon receivers have been removed. They are now displayed in the same menu from their plugin.
– Fixed bugs on the LCD 400 displays for Setups and Menus. Added some missing screens thanks to @Riojano for the reports.
Tuners & Scanning:
– Display a message if the Last Scanned bouquet has not been created, with the action to perform to create it.
– Added a BLUE button to use Extras in Auto Search & Signals.
– Simplified the message if a tuner is deconfigured. The goal of this change is to make it more intuitive:
Before: Yes, Yes to all, No, No to all. Now: Delete channels or Do not delete channels (from the channel list used with the previous configuration of the already deconfigured tuner).
– Added a detailed description if recording is initiated from the backup tuner.
– Note: Satellite AutoDiSEqC is still being tested on more tuners due to known issues; it is not yet implemented.
Timers:
– The Feed Timers menu has been renamed to Scheduled Timers.
– The Scheduled Search menu has been renamed to Automatic Event Search.
– Fixed issues in the actions dialog for the timer added to Automatic Event Search. The interface has been improved.
Skins:
– Default Skin: Added a green “Subserv” button in the InfoBar if the channel has subservices. The setting is to “always show” these types of channels, otherwise it shows “Plugins”.
– Added a customization plugin for the openspa_JRLG skin.
– Some minor fixes.
– The channel list screen is now compatible with other skins not developed by OpenSPA, as reported by samlukin.
IPToSAT:
– Fixed issues when using SSL HTTPS.
– Updated the code to avoid FATAL SIGNAL issues in IPTV lists created by the plugin.
GBVFDControl:
– Some fixes.
Movie Selection:
– Display the “Movie Selection” menu (disc recordings) in Settings. This must be enabled in the OSD Configuration section. This is useful for controllers without a direct PVR key.
